Afghan Refugees Would Not Forcefully Deported From Australia

MEP: Australian Prime Minister promised to President Mohammad Ashraf Ghani that in addition to supporting Afghanistan, forced return of Afghan refugees to their country, will not be raised.

The decision was taken in the final days of President Ghani’s visit in Australia and Malcolm Turnbull promised that Afghan refugees can follow up their migration process request with a calm mind.

Australian media reported that the country has made virtuous promises for Afghanistan in various sectors and is expected, Australia’s role in Afghanistan to be more than before.

This comes as coinciding with the President’s trip to Australia, a large number of Afghan refugees that their requests did not accept and are threatened with fear of forced eviction, had protested in Canberra.

The protesters demanded the revision of the 2011 agreement between Afghanistan and Australia in the forced return of refugees to Afghanistan.
